FAISALABAD: Govt rejects proposal for new taxes

By Our Staff Correspondent


FAISALABAD, Sept 28: The Punjab government has turned down the move of Tehsil Municipal Administration (City) for the imposition of 121 taxes and 41 fees and asked it to withdraw them immediately.

TMA sources said here on Tuesday the TMA had sent a proposal with the approved budget document for the year 2004-05 to the Punjab government seeking formal approval to collect taxes and fees.

However, the government refused to allow it to impose new taxes as well as increase some of the previous fees and taxes. On receiving the refusal, the TMA presented fresh schedule of 31 taxes before the house for getting formal approval.
